A COO’s role is integral to any enterprise’s success, serving as the right hand to the CEO and ensuring the seamless functioning of business operations. The COO is often tasked with translating strategy into action, leading critical functions ranging from operations and finance to sales and marketing.

W HEN A CEO first assumes their position or joins a new company, they’re often quick to make changes to the executive team, creating a group of trusted advisors who will drive their strategic agenda. But once the CEO has been in place for a few years, this dynamic changes. As one anonymous Fortune 500 CEO shared: My CFO started well.
